Before preparing the drives for an import job, you should create a drive set CSV file and an XML manifest file. The drive set CSV file is used to list the drives that you will be using for the import job. Each line in the CSV represents a single drive and includes details such as the drive ID and the corresponding blob information.
The XML manifest file is a crucial component of the import process that tells the import service how the data is structured and how to process it. It typically includes information on where to locate the data on the drive, metadata about the data, and how to handle any errors that might arise.
